Abstract
In order to better leverage the role of the enhanced resistivity micro-imager(ERMI),independently developed by COSL,in exploration,development and geological evaluation,to enhance its application effect in complex formations such as the Missan oilfield in Iraq,this paper introduces the working principle of ERMI electrical imaging logging tool and analyzes the geological condition and structural characteristics of Missan oilfield in Iraq.Based on the actual operation in Misang oilfield in the early stage,a set of operational techniques suitable for the formation characteristics of the region has been summarized from the preparation work before ERMI electrical imaging logging operation,instrument parameter optimization combination,log-ging data quality control,on-site operation precautions,and other aspects.Rich application results have been achieved in data processing and comprehensive interpretation.关键词
